Fun and Exciting Outdoor Games for 6-Year-Olds

Introduction: Being outdoors is not only healthy for kids, but it also provides them with countless opportunities to learn, socialize, and have fun. If you have a 6-year-old in your life, it's essential to encourage their love for outdoor activities by engaging them in games that are age-appropriate, safe, and enjoyable. In this article, we have compiled a list of exciting outdoor games that will keep your 6-year-old entertained and active. 1. Tag: Tag is a classic game loved by children of all ages. It encourages running, improves physical coordination, and teaches children about concepts like speed, evasion, and strategy. To make it more interesting for your 6-year-old, you can introduce variations such as freeze tag or flashlight tag, where being tagged means freezing or being illuminated by a flashlight until someone unfreezes you. 2. Red Light, Green Light: This game is perfect for teaching your child about movement control. One person plays the role of the "stoplight" while the others line up a few meters away from them. When the stoplight says "green light," the participants move forward, but they must freeze immediately when it says "red light." The stoplight turns around sporadically, catching anyone still moving. The first person to reach the stoplight wins and becomes the next stoplight. 3. Duck, Duck, Goose: This classic game is an excellent way to improve social skills and encourage interaction among children. Participants sit in a circle, and one person walks around, tapping each child's head, saying "duck" each time. Eventually, they tap someone and shout "goose!" The chosen child then chases the tapper around the circle, trying to catch them before they take the vacant spot. If successful, the tapper becomes the new goose, and the game continues. 4. Obstacle Courses: Designing an obstacle course in your backyard is a fantastic way to engage your 6-year-old's physical and mental abilities. Use cones, hula hoops, jumping ropes, and other objects to create a challenging and fun-filled course. Encourage your child to navigate through the course as quickly as possible, incorporating activities like running, jumping, crawling, and balancing. Time each attempt to encourage a fun and friendly competition. 5. Soccer: Soccer is a popular and age-appropriate sport that helps develop teamwork, coordination, and gross motor skills. Set up a small field in your backyard or head to a local park with your child and a few friends to enjoy a friendly game of soccer. Simplify the rules and focus on learning basic skills, such as dribbling, passing, and shooting. Remember, the emphasis should be on fun and participation rather than competition at this age. Conclusion: Outdoor games provide valuable opportunities for 6-year-olds to learn and grow while having a great time. Whether it's running, socializing, or enhancing physical coordination, these games offer a multitude of benefits for your child's development. So, gear up, head outside, and let the fun begin!
